• Resolved aga2442

    (@aga2442)


    hello,

    I have pro version (2.9) which is an old version of your plugin. I could not update to the latest version due to fees.
    
    The theme I use supports php 8 version.
    
    but when I activate php 8, no ads running through your plugin will work.
    
    I wonder if I have a problem because I have an old version?
Viewing 3 replies - 1 through 3 (of 3 total)
  • Plugin Support Henning

    (@henningaa)

    Hi aga2442,

    Thanks for reaching out.

    Advanced Ads supports PHP 8 and you should be able to show ads in your theme. I recommend starting with the basic plugin and a dummy ad to ensure the general ad injection is working as expected.

    After this, I suggest activating and testing the Advanced Ads Pro add-on and it’s functionalities one by one to see what exactly is not working. Looking for error messages in your browsers’ console or PHP log files might help to understand what is not working in particular.

    Due to the theme change, the elements on your website might also have changed. I recommend re-creating your previous placements, like the Custom Position placement or sidebars, if used, so it can work as expected.

    Version 2.9 is about two years old by now, I might not say if there were changes on WordPress, PHP, and the add-on until now braking some functionalities. Following the steps above should give a better idea on what is not working exactly.

    Kindly note that this forum is only for the support of the free Advanced Ads plugin, which is also hosted here. Questions about the paid add-ons can be addressed to our customer support.

    Best regards,
    Henning

    Thread Starter aga2442

    (@aga2442)

    @henningaa

    thank you for the information.
    
    my website currently uses php 7 version and everything works fine.
    
    but when I activate php 8;
    
    All adsense ads will be active.
    There is no problem with the theme.
    
    the main problem is:
    
    On some special pages with the help of the advanced ads plugin; I'm using a shortcode of a different plugin. Example: slider plugin. or I use the theme's shortcodes for those who log in or not on some pages.
    
    When php 8 is active, the fields I activated with the shortcode method do not work.
    Plugin Support Henning

    (@henningaa)

    Hi aga242,

    When php 8 is active, the fields I activated with the shortcode method do not work.

    Is this about the shortcodes injected with Advanced Ads or using the shortcode from the manual placement to create an ad spot?

    On some special pages with the help of the advanced ads plugin; I’m using a shortcode of a different plugin. Example: slider plugin. or I use the theme’s shortcodes for those who log in or not on some pages.

    I understand Advanced Ads does work with PHP 8 on your website, but on some positions, third-party elements injected with Advanced Ads are missing.

    Please try a dummy ad on that exact position you are wanted to use the shortcodes. This way you can find out more about the origin of this issue.

    If the dummy is showing, the problem would be with the third-party-plugins if the dummy is not showing, I recommend trying the general debugging steps suggested in the manual above.

    Best regards,
    Henning

Viewing 3 replies - 1 through 3 (of 3 total)
  • The topic ‘php 8 problem’ is closed to new replies.